GALLOWS POSTPONE 2 DATES BUT CONTINUE TOUR

Gallows forced to cancel UK shows as frontman Frank Carter splits head open onstage.

Gallows have sadly had to cancel two dates on their current UK tour due to a head injury frontman Frank Carter received onstage at The Sugarmill in Stoke on the 15th of September.

The following dates will be rescheduled for December:

18 Sep Fat Sams Dundee
19 Sep Town Hall Crypt Middlesborough


The rest of the tour will continue as normal at the following dates:

21 Sep Charlotte Leicester
22 Sep Soundhaus Northampton
23 Sep Junction Cambridge
25 Sep Carling Academy Oxford
26 Sep Electric Ballroom London

28 Sep Voodoo Lounge Dublin
29 Sep Limelight Belfast

Below follows a statement from Frank Carter:

“So while I was singing "Nervous Breakdown" I managed to trip over some kid and plant my head firmly into a monitor. I was pretty ****ed up and it took me a while to get to my feet. When I eventually did manage to stand up it was quite apparent from the faces in the front row that I wasn’t ok. I managed to put a one-inch deep gash in the top of my head and had blood running from my hairline to my chin. I finished the song and then went out to check my head was ok. Our guitar tech and good friend Nidge had a look at it and decided I needed some stitches. I went to A&E in Stoke and had my head glued back together. By the time I had got back to venue the show was over and I was gutted.”

“I want to say thank you to my youngest brother Richard Carter from Blackhole who stood in and finished the set for us...thanks fella. However, it didn’t end there! Unfortunately I have mild concussion and so have had to pull the next few shows to get my head back together and make sure I don’t take any more serious knocks. My most sincere apologies to anyone who was coming out to the shows. You have no idea how gutted I am we had to cancel the shows.”

“Thanks for everyone’s understanding and patience. I really appreciate it.”

Frank Carter

Gallows.

Support on the tour comes from Poison The Well, Lethal Bizzle and Blackhole.
